<description>i too am considering concrete counter tops! i love the modern look and how it can really highlight vibrant colors. plus they are basically scratch and stain proof! here is what i have learned so far about concrete countertops.      1. in order for the counter to actually be eco-friendly, you need to use fly ash and a non-petroleum based sealer. most concrete produced is from portland cement, and it consumes more energy and pollutes more than any other industry including steel and plastics.  It contributes 5-8% of all greenhouse gases just by itself. Fly ash is a waste product of a coal combustion plant. Fly ash cement has greater corrosion resistance, substantially higher fire resistance (up to 2400&amp;deg; F), greater strength and less permeability.  2. concrete counter tops are extremely durable but it depends upon the sealer you put on top. concrete must be properly sealed in order to resist stains or damage and they recommend &amp;quot;waxing&amp;quot; the counter regularly to protect the sealer. and they say cutting directly on the concrete will damage the sealer (not to mention your knives!).  3. if you&amp;#039;re ambitious you can even get a DIY concrete counter top kit! haven&amp;#039;t looked too much into these yet so im not sure if they use fly ash or not. sounds challenging but rewarding if it work out!  i found alot of info on &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.themoderngreen.com&quot; target=&quot;_blank&quot;&gt;www.themoderngreen.com&lt;/a&gt; and &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.concretecountertopinstitute.com&quot; target=&quot;_blank&quot;&gt;www.concretecountertopinstitute.com&lt;/a&gt; hope this helps! i would love to hear about what you end up doing!  </description>
